A period of heightened activity in an online multiplayer game when new players arrive in droves.
During this period, veterans help acclimate the newcomers (by fragging them over and over), while the game hosts deal with the increased server demand (and the coincidental flood of vets complaining about flood-induced lag and outages).
Typically caused by said players acquiring the game for Christmas—often months or years after the game was first released—but also on the rare occasions that a paid game becomes free to play.
